Learning outcomes
The student is able to
- evaluate their competencies and the requirements of working life
- develop and deepen their business competencies
- analyse and develop the content of their work and the operation of the organisation as a member of the work community
- establish personal working life connections and act in networks
- evaluate their competencies and their development
- plan their study path and career
Teaching methods
During the second internship period, the student develops and deepens their expertise in a chosen area of specialization. The internship strengthens connections with working life and helps the students learn to assess their own career opportunities.
The student is responsible for finding their own internship placement. A suitable placement can be a company, a public organization, or another type of organization. The student’s own business or current workplace may also be acceptable if the job content meets the objectives of the internship and the company has a Business ID. This should be discussed and agreed upon with the internship supervisor (your assigned tutor teacher).
The internship includes a learning assignment. Submit it as soon as possible, but no later than one month after the internship ends, to the internship supervisor. A feedback discussion will be held during the internship at a time specified by the supervisor.
You will receive a passing mark (H) for the internship once you have submitted the learning assignment and a copy of your work/internship certificate to the internship supervisor and participated in the feedback discussion. In addition, you must have entered the internship placement details into the PRM system.
